Warranty
Furman Sound, LLC warrants to the original purchaser of this product, the Furman PST-
8, that the product will be free from defects in material and workmanship for a period of
three years from the date of purchase. The purchaser of the product is allowed fteen
days from the date of purchase to complete warranty registration by mail or on-line at
the Furman website. If the purchaser fails to complete the aforementioned registration,
the warranty period will be reduced to one year from the date of purchase.
If the product does not conform to this Limited Warranty during the warranty period (as
herein above specied), purchaser shall notify Furman in writing of the claimed defects.
If the defects are of such type and nature as to be covered by this warranty, Furman
shall authorize the purchaser to return the product to the Furman factory or to an
authorized Furman repair location. Warranty claims should be accompanied by a copy
of the original purchase invoice showing the purchase date; this is not necessary if the
Warranty Registration was completed either by mailing in the completed warranty card
or by registering on-line at the Furman website. Shipping charges to the Furman factory
or to an authorized repair location must be prepaid by the purchaser of the product.
Furman shall, at its own expense, furnish a replacement product or, at Furman’s option,
repair the defective product. Return shipping charges back to purchaser will be paid
by Furman.
